Transaction 75608cbf726f64f33098e03ea82a167a89dc2571ab677fa25c31f82dc05940e5
1 Input
1 Output
-
75608cbf726f64f33098e03ea82a167a89dc2571ab677fa25c31f82dc05940e5:0
- value
- 104400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3a4835eceb67e70dbfbc8351ae7e9fc8d5e25fd OP_EQUAL
- address
- 3GcH9PQuwXy3Y1BE1Q7zdNsqvhg7kGL5nT